Owner report 11098125 · 2018-05-26 (May 26, 2018)

I ALMOST HAD A TERRIBLE ACCIDENT IN MY 2 WEEK OLD 2018 M5 ON THE 1-95 HIGHWAY ON THE NIGHT OF MAY 25, 2018 AT ABOUT 9:45PM. WITHOUT WARNING, AT ABOUT 65MPH, THE CAR JERKED FOR ABOUT 3SECONDS , KICKED OUT OF DRIVE INTO NEUTRAL AND STARTED DECELERATING. I WAS IN THE MIDDLE LANE SURROUNDED BY SPEEDING VEHICLES. I MANAGED TO GUIDE IT TO THE SHOULDER AND TURNED OFF THE IGNITION FOR 2MINUTES, AFTER WHICH I RE-STARTED THE CAR AND WAS ABLE TO ENGAGE DRIVE. I CONTACTED MY DEALERSHIP TODAY, ONLY TO BE INFORMED, THIS WAS AS A RESULT OF COMPUTER GLITCH C…
